CentOSインストールGhostブログ

1537 ワード

インストールNode.js
yum -y install gcc-c++ openssl-devel  bzip2-devel

次にPythonのバージョンをチェックします
python -V
Python 2.4.3

pythonバージョンが低いためnodejsのインストール中にエラーが発生します.ここではまずpythonをアップグレードします.
wget -c http://www.python.org/ftp/python/2.7.3/Python-2.7.3.tar.bz2
tar jxvf Python-2.7.3.tar.bz2
cd Python-2.7.3

この時点でインストールできます
./configure
make && make install
ここには小さなテクニックがあります.make installのとき、後ろにパラメータがあります.-j 4,4はどれだけの核を表していますか.もしあなたの速度を高めたいなら、まずあなたの機械がどれだけの核を持っているかを見てみましょう.そして<=核でいいです.この速度ではもっと速くなります
私はこれは安物で、単核なので、あきらめました.
インストールが完了しても実際には機能しません.デフォルトは2.4.3です.新しいバージョンを古いバージョンに置き換えてデフォルトにします.
mv /usr/bin/python /usr/bin/python.bak
ln -s /usr/local/bin/python2.7 /usr/bin/python
このとき、次のコマンドを実行して、アップグレードに成功したかどうかを確認します.
python -V
この時点でPythonはアップグレードに成功しましたが、yumは古いバージョンで正常に動作する必要があります.yum全体をデバッグしてアップグレードする必要がない場合は、yumのプロファイルを変更するだけでいいです.
vi /usr/bin/yum
#!/usr/bin/python   #!/usr/bin/python2.4

nodejsのインストール
wget http://nodejs.org/dist/v0.10.24/node-v0.10.24.tar.gz
 
tar zxvf node-v0.10.24.tar.gz
 
cd node-v0.10.24
 
./configure
 
make && make install

Ghostブログのインストール
wget --no-check-certificate https://ghost.org/zip/ghost-latest.zip
 
unzip  ghost*.zip -d ghost
 
cd ghost
 
npm install --production

次は起動です
npm start